Following the announcement of the line-up for the New Orleans Jazz and Heritage Festival, Superfly Productions has confirmed the details of its Superfly During Jazzfest Series. These shows will take place late night following the music at the festival proper (and during the days between happenings at the fairgrounds). As with past years, Superfly will host events on the Riverboat Cajun Queen with Garage a Trois on April 23rd and the Radiators on the 24th. In addition, Gov’t Mule will celebrate its 10 Anniversary with two shows at the Orpheum Theatre on April 30 and May 1. Other shows include Wilco at the Orpheum Theatre on the 23rd, a Charlie Hunter Trio residency at the Mermaid Lounge from April 24-27, Sound Tribe Sector 9 at the Twi-Ro-Pa Live Room on May 1, Tortoise at the Twi-Ro-Pa Tchoupitoulas Room on May 2 as well as two Galactic dates, on the 24th at Twi-Ro-Pa Live Room and May 1st at the State Palace Theater with Jurassic 5.
